Chapter 685 Fatal Blow (2)

After Zhang Hao discovered that the giant beast's eyes might be its weakness, he shouted loudly: "Attack its eyes!" His voice echoed in the valley with determination and firmness.

Upon hearing this, everyone turned their attacks towards the beast's eyes. The woman concentrated, beads of sweat on her forehead. Her hands danced faster and faster, muttering something to herself. A blinding light gathered in her hands, like the breaking light of dawn, and shot straight at the beast's left eye. The light was so bright that it seemed to scorch the air wherever it passed.

The herbalist threw the stick in his hand with all his might towards the giant beast's eyes. His eyes were filled with determination, and the stick, carrying his last hope and courage, flew towards the target with a roar.

The old man quickly drew a powerful spell. His fingers moved with swiftness, and the lines on the spell shone with a mysterious light. As he chanted the spell, his voice was deep and powerful, like a call from an ancient time. The spell transformed into a streak of golden light and rushed towards the beast with lightning speed.

The black-robed figure clasped his hands together, muttering something to himself. His body trembled slightly, evidently mobilizing all his magical energy. A powerful force converged before him, forming a massive sphere. The sphere shone with a faint blue light, and the surrounding space seemed to be warped by its immense power. Then, the sphere blasted towards the beast's right eye, the roar of the wind it stirred like thunder.

The behemoth sensed their intentions and frantically swung its head, attempting to evade the attack. Its massive body twisted, whipping up a gust of wind that uprooted surrounding trees. However, under the dense and precise attacks of the crowd, it was unable to completely avoid them.

The woman's magic first struck the beast's left eye, and it roared in agony, a deafening roar. The sound seemed to pierce the heavens, and the entire valley trembled at the roar. Blood gushed from its left eye like a fountain, splashing onto the ground, instantly staining it red.

Immediately afterwards, the herbalist's wooden stick and the old man's talisman hit the giant beast one after another. Blood flowed from its left eye and its eyeball became blurred.

At this moment, the black-robed man's magic ball accurately hit the beast's right eye. Under the impact of the magic ball, the right eye instantly exploded, and blood and flesh flew everywhere.

The beast, its eyes injured, was instantly enraged. It attacked everything around it, its massive body charging forward. Its claws slammed the ground, sending up huge waves of dirt; its tail shattered boulders wherever it swept.

"Everyone be careful!" Zhang Hao shouted. His voice was drowned out by the beast's roar, but his eyes remained fixed on the beast's movements, ready to respond at any moment.

But the crowd didn't retreat. They huddled together, supporting each other. Taking advantage of the beast's injury and confusion, Zhang Hao seized the opportunity and leaped into the air. His figure, like a nimble eagle, traced a graceful arc through the air. Sword in hand, he thrust with all his might into the beast's eye.

The sword flashed a cold light through the air and accurately pierced the beast's injured left eye. The blade sank into it all the way to the hilt.

The beast let out a shrill cry, its voice filled with pain and despair. Its massive body began to stagger, like a collapsing mountain.

Zhang Hao quickly drew his sword and swung it again at the beast's neck. The blade rubbed against the beast's skin, sending out a string of sparks.

Under the combined attack of everyone, the giant beast finally fell to the ground with a loud bang, stirring up a cloud of dust. The dust flew all over the sky, enveloping everyone.

"We succeeded!" the herbalist shouted excitedly. His voice became hoarse with excitement, and his face was filled with a mixture of joy and exhaustion.

Everyone collapsed to the ground exhausted, gasping for breath. Their bodies had reached their limit, every muscle ached, every breath seemed so difficult.

However, before they could celebrate, a strange sound was heard in the valley again. The sound was low and dull, as if it came from deep underground.

"What is this?" the woman asked in horror, her voice still trembling from the battle.

Zhang Hao forced himself to stand up, gripping his sword tightly. "No matter what, we must be prepared."

The old man gasped and said, "Perhaps there are more dangers waiting for us in this valley."

The black-robed man looked in the direction of the voice, his face solemn, "Everyone be careful, there might be a stronger enemy."

The herbalist swallowed hard, "We just defeated this giant beast, let's not expect another one that's even more difficult to deal with."

As the sound got closer, the ground began to shake slightly. Everyone's mood became tense again, and their nerves, which had just relaxed, were instantly tense again.

Suddenly, a group of ghostly shadows rushed out from the depths of the valley...
